CVE-2026-56692
Vulnerability summary (CVE-2026-56692): NanoClaw prior to 2.1.17 contains a symlink-following flaw in forwardAttachedFiles that can exfiltrate host-readable files. The host validates attachments with isSafeAttachmentName, then copies via fs.copyFileSync, which follows symlinks without containment...

SUSE CVE-2026-50141
Woodpecker is a CI/CD engine. Starting in version 3.0.0 and prior to version 3.14.1, a vulnerability in Woodpecker CI's gRPC layer allowed any authenticated agent to impersonate any other agent on the same server by injecting a forged agentid value into outgoing gRPC metadata.
